girlfriend

n.
US //ˈɡɝɫˌfɹɛnd// UK //ɡˈɜːlfɹɛnd// girl·friend
  1. 1 romantic partner (n.)
    A1 Beginner

    a woman or girl that someone is having a romantic relationship with.

    a female partner in a non-marital romantic relationship.

    Example

    He invited his girlfriend to meet his parents for dinner on Saturday.

    Example

    After dating for nearly three years, he finally introduced his girlfriend to his extended family during the holiday celebrations.

  2. 2 female friend (n.)
    B1 Intermediate Informal

    a woman's female friend.

    a female friend of another female; often used in plural to refer to a social group.

    Example

    She is going out for coffee with her girlfriends this afternoon.

    Example

    She maintained a close-knit circle of girlfriends from her university days, meeting them annually for a weekend retreat.

  1. 3 term of address (n.)
    B2 Upper Intermediate Informal Slang

    a friendly way to address a woman or a gay man.

    a familiar term of address used among women or within the gay community to signal rapport.

    Example

    Listen, girlfriend, you need to stop worrying about what he thinks.

    Example

    The speaker used the term 'girlfriend' as a playful, supportive interjection during their conversation about career goals.

Origin

Compound of girl + friend.
